Can I get into Ryerson with a 70 average?
A minimum overall average of 70% in six Grade 12 U/M courses establishes your eligibility to apply for admission. Ryerson receives more applications than spaces available. For current Ontario secondary school applicants, Ryerson may use Grade 11 results in the early admission selection process.

You will need to study science at university, take the required undergraduate courses, and perform well. Then, apply to one of the 10 pharmacy schools in Canada (two are French-language). Admissions are competitive. At the University of Alberta, for example, students from within the province need a GPA of 3.5 (out of four) to be considered.
